void Scrollbar::startTimerIfNeeded(double delay)
{
    // Don't do anything for the thumb.
    if (m_pressedPart == ThumbPart)
        return;

    // Handle the track.  We halt track scrolling once the thumb is level
    // with us.
    if ((m_pressedPart == BackTrackPart || m_pressedPart == ForwardTrackPart) && thumbUnderMouse(this)) {
        setNeedsPaintInvalidation();
        setHoveredPart(ThumbPart);
        return;
    }

    // We can't scroll if we've hit the beginning or end.
    ScrollDirectionPhysical dir = pressedPartScrollDirectionPhysical();
    if (dir == ScrollUp || dir == ScrollLeft) {
        if (m_currentPos == 0)
            return;
    } else {
        if (m_currentPos == maximum())
            return;
    }

    m_scrollTimer.startOneShot(delay, BLINK_FROM_HERE);
}

void Scrollbar::autoscrollPressedPart(double delay)
{
    // Don't do anything for the thumb or if nothing was pressed.
    if (m_pressedPart == ThumbPart || m_pressedPart == NoPart)
        return;

    // Handle the track.
    if ((m_pressedPart == BackTrackPart || m_pressedPart == ForwardTrackPart) && thumbUnderMouse(this)) {
        setNeedsPaintInvalidation();
        setHoveredPart(ThumbPart);
        return;
    }

    // Handle the arrows and track.
    if (m_scrollableArea && m_scrollableArea->userScroll(pressedPartScrollDirectionPhysical(), pressedPartScrollGranularity()).didScroll)
        startTimerIfNeeded(delay);
}

bool Scrollbar::gestureEvent(const PlatformGestureEvent& evt,
                             bool* shouldUpdateCapture) {
  DCHECK(shouldUpdateCapture);
  switch (evt.type()) {
    case PlatformEvent::GestureTapDown:
      setPressedPart(theme().hitTest(*this, evt.position()));
      m_pressedPos = orientation() == HorizontalScrollbar
                         ? convertFromRootFrame(evt.position()).x()
                         : convertFromRootFrame(evt.position()).y();
      *shouldUpdateCapture = true;
      return true;
    case PlatformEvent::GestureTapDownCancel:
      if (m_pressedPart != ThumbPart)
        return false;
      m_scrollPos = m_pressedPos;
      return true;
    case PlatformEvent::GestureScrollBegin:
      switch (evt.source()) {
        case PlatformGestureSourceTouchpad:
          // Update the state on GSB for touchpad since GestureTapDown
          // is not generated by that device. Touchscreen uses the tap down
          // gesture since the scrollbar enters a visual active state.
          *shouldUpdateCapture = true;
          setPressedPart(NoPart);
          m_pressedPos = 0;
          return true;
        case PlatformGestureSourceTouchscreen:
          if (m_pressedPart != ThumbPart)
            return false;
          m_scrollPos = m_pressedPos;
          return true;
        default:
          ASSERT_NOT_REACHED();
          return true;
      }
      break;
    case PlatformEvent::GestureScrollUpdate:
      switch (evt.source()) {
        case PlatformGestureSourceTouchpad: {
          FloatSize delta(-evt.deltaX(), -evt.deltaY());
          if (m_scrollableArea &&
              m_scrollableArea->userScroll(evt.deltaUnits(), delta)
                  .didScroll()) {
            return true;
          }
          return false;
        }
        case PlatformGestureSourceTouchscreen:
          if (m_pressedPart != ThumbPart)
            return false;
          m_scrollPos += orientation() == HorizontalScrollbar ? evt.deltaX()
                                                              : evt.deltaY();
          moveThumb(m_scrollPos, false);
          return true;
        default:
          ASSERT_NOT_REACHED();
          return true;
      }
      break;
    case PlatformEvent::GestureScrollEnd:
    case PlatformEvent::GestureLongPress:
    case PlatformEvent::GestureFlingStart:
      m_scrollPos = 0;
      m_pressedPos = 0;
      setPressedPart(NoPart);
      return false;
    case PlatformEvent::GestureTap: {
      if (m_pressedPart != ThumbPart && m_pressedPart != NoPart &&
          m_scrollableArea &&
          m_scrollableArea
              ->userScroll(
                  pressedPartScrollGranularity(),
                  toScrollDelta(pressedPartScrollDirectionPhysical(), 1))
              .didScroll()) {
        return true;
      }
      m_scrollPos = 0;
      m_pressedPos = 0;
      setPressedPart(NoPart);
      return false;
    }
    default:
      // By default, we assume that gestures don't deselect the scrollbar.
      return true;
  }
}
